Do you know how to manage Increased Intracranial Pressure (ICP)?

Dr. Evie Marcolini discusses managing elevated intracranial pressure (ICP) in critical care and emergency medicine settings. She emphasizes the importance of preserving cerebral perfusion pressure (CPP) in brain injury or hemorrhage cases. The treatment follows a tiered approach, starting with a thorough assessment and simple interventions like head elevation, analgesia, and osmotic therapy with Mannitol or Hypertonic Saline. More invasive measures, such as vasoactive agents and paralytics, are considered in tier two, while tier three involves options like burst suppression with Phenobarbital or Craniectomy. Dr. Marcolini highlights the significance of understanding the underlying mechanism and choosing appropriate treatments to manage elevated ICP effectively.
